    Description

    Interim HealthCare is seeking a dependable, organized and relationship-focused Home Care Scheduling Coordinator to support our growing Home Care division.

    This position is responsible for coordinating caregiver schedules, filling open shifts, responding promptly to call-offs and maintaining consistent communication with clients, families, caregivers and the administrative team. The ideal candidate thrives in a fast-paced environment, takes ownership of unresolved scheduling needs and understands how reliable staffing directly affects the clients we serve.

    Schedule:
    Full-time, Monday through Friday, 9:00 a.m.–5:30 p.m., with flexibility based on client and scheduling needs. Occasional after-hours support or participation in an on-call rotation is required.

    Pay:
    $20.00–$23.00 per hour, based on relevant home care and scheduling experience.

    Primary Responsibilities:

    • Coordinate and maintain caregiver schedules for Home Care clients.
    • Match caregivers according to availability, qualifications, location, client needs and personality compatibility.
    • Respond promptly to caregiver call-offs, open shifts and schedule changes.
    • Proactively contact qualified caregivers to secure coverage.
    • Confirm upcoming shifts and address potential coverage concerns before they become emergencies.
    • Communicate schedule updates clearly with clients, families, caregivers and internal team members.
    • Maintain accurate schedules, caregiver availability and documentation in AxisCare.
    • Monitor attendance, late arrivals, missed clock-ins and unconfirmed shifts.
    • Assist with new-client starts, caregiver introductions and ongoing assignments.
    • Follow up with clients and caregivers regarding schedule satisfaction and ongoing needs.
    • Escalate attendance, performance, client-care or safety concerns to the appropriate manager.
    • Communicate unresolved scheduling needs during team and on-call handoffs.
    • Provide occasional scheduling support for the Staffing division as needed.
    • Protect confidential client and employee information.

    Qualifications:

    • Previous home care, healthcare scheduling, staffing or customer-service experience preferred.
    • Strong communication and relationship-building skills.
    • Excellent organization and attention to detail.
    • Ability to manage competing priorities and frequent schedule changes.
    • Comfortable making frequent phone calls and sending professional texts and messages.
    • Ability to remain calm, professional and solution-focused under pressure.
    • Strong computer skills and the ability to learn scheduling software.
    • Experience with AxisCare or another home care scheduling system is a plus.
    • Reliable attendance and consistent availability are required.

    What Success Looks Like:

    • Open shifts are addressed promptly and followed through to resolution.
    • Clients, families and caregivers receive timely communication.
    • Schedules and documentation remain accurate and current.
    • Potential coverage concerns are identified early.
    • Responsibilities are owned through completion.
    • Caregivers are matched thoughtfully with clients.
    • Clients receive dependable, consistent care.
